Class conflict: the ongoing tension between the appropriating and producing class. Labour union: is a group of workers who join together to bargain with an employer or group of employers with regard to wages, benefits and working conditions. Socioeconomic status (ses): differences between people linked either to income or to some combination of income, occupation, and education.
